Detailed Job Description: The New York State Department of Health (NYSDOH) Bureau of Surveillance and Data Systems is charged to maintain and enhance the statewide Electronic Clinical Laboratory Reporting System (ECLRS), the Communicable Disease Electronic Surveillance System (CDESS), and the Electronic Syndromic Surveillance System (ESSS). These are mission critical electronic systems to effectively monitor and respond to over 75 reportable diseases and to other public health emergencies and inform statewide policy decisions.
